Radion Stabilization In 5D SUGRA

Abstract

We present a detailed study of radion stabilization within 5D conformal SUGRA compactified on an S(1)/Z2S^{(1)}/Z_2 orbifold. We use an effective 4D superfield description developed in our previous work. The effects of tree level bulk and boundary couplings, and in particular of one loop contributions and of a non perturbative correction on the radion stabilization are investigated. We find new examples of radion stabilization in non SUSY and (meta-stable) SUSY preserving Minkowski vacua.
